Um in WPF unter VB.NET Daten aus einer Access-Datenbank in eine ListBox einzulesen, kannst du die folgenden Schritte befolgen: 1. Verweise hinzufügen: Stelle sicher, dass du die notwendigen Verw...
Wie kann ich eine Access-Datenbank in WPF unter VB.NET anzeigen lassen?
Antwort vomUm eine Access-Datenbank in einer WPF-Anwendung unter VB.NET anzuzeigen, kannst du die folgenden Schritte befolgen: 1. **Datenbankverbindung einrichten**: Stelle sicher, dass du die benötigtenweise auf `System.Data` und `System.Data.OleDb` in deinem Projekt hast. 2. **Datenbankabfrage durchführen**: Verwende `OleDbConnection` und `OleDbCommand`, um Daten aus der Access-Datenbank abzurufen. 3. **Daten in ein DataGrid anzeigen**: Binde die abgerufenen Daten an ein `DataGrid` in deiner WPF-Oberfläche. Hier ist ein einfaches Beispiel: ```vb Imports System.Data.OleDb Class MainWindow Private Sub MainWindow_Loaded(sender As Object, e As RoutedEventArgs) ' Verbindung zur Access-Datenbank Dim connectionString As String = "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=C:\Pfad\zu\deiner\Datenbank.accdb;" Dim connection As New OleDbConnection(connectionString) Try connection.Open() Dim command As New OleDbCommand("SELECT * FROM DeineTabelle", connection) Dim adapter As New OleDbDataAdapter(command) Dim table As New DataTable() adapter.Fill(table) ' Daten an DataGrid binden MyDataGrid.ItemsSource = table.DefaultView Catch ex As Exception MessageBox.Show("Fehler: " & ex.Message) Finally connection.Close() End Try End Sub End Class ``` In diesem Beispiel: - Ersetze `C:\Pfad\zu\deiner\Datenbank.accdb` mit dem tatsächlichen Pfad zu deiner Access-Datenbank. - Ersetze `DeineTabelle` mit dem Namen der Tabelle, die du anzeigen möchtest. - Stelle sicher, dass du ein `DataGrid` mit dem Namen `MyDataGrid` in deinem XAML definiert hast. Das Beispiel zeigt, wie du beim Laden des Fensters eine Verbindung zur Datenbank herstellst, Daten abfragst und diese in einem DataGrid anzeigst.
Verwandte Fragen
Warum findet Access trotz schema.ini bei DoCmd.TransferText die Exportdatei nicht?
Es gibt mehrere Gründe, warum Access beim Exportieren mit DoCmd.TransferText trotz einer vorhandenen schema.ini-Datei die Exportdatei nicht finden kann: 1. Pfad zur Datei: Überprüfe, o...
Wie kann ich in Access eine Namensliste erstellen?
Um in Microsoft Access eine Namensliste zu erstellen, kannst du die folgenden Schritte befolgen: 1. Datenbank erstellen: Öffne Microsoft Access und erstelle eine neue Datenbank. 2. Tabelle erst...
ID3-Tag in Access auslesen
Um ID3-Tags in Microsoft Access auszulesen, kannst du VBA (Visual Basic for Applications) verwenden Hier ist eine allgemeine Vorgehensweise: 1. Referenz hinzufügen: Stelle sicher, dass du die Wi...